SHRM Weekly Online Survey: August 2, 2006
Employment Eligibility Verification (I9)
• Sample comprised of 306 randomly selected HR professionals.
• Analyzing 306 responses of 2885 emails sent, 2661 emails were received (response rate = 12%).
• Survey fielded August 2 – August 8 2006; presentation generated on August 10, 2006.
• Margin of error is +/- 5%.

Does your organization conduct I-9 (Employment Eligibility Verification) audits?
Choice Count Percentage Answered
Yes, on an ad hoc basis 91 31%
Yes, annually 73 25%
No, never 70 24%
No, but we plan to start conducting audits 27 9%
Yes, every six months 18 6%
Other 13 5%
Note: Excludes respondents who answered “Don’t know”.

Does your organization have staff (e.g., a compliance officer) specifically dedicated to conducting I-9 (Employment Eligibility Verification) audits?
Choice Count Percentage Answered
Yes 55 26%
No 154 74%
Note: Excludes respondents who answered “Don’t know”.

How does your organization respond to false documentation uncovered during I-9 (Employment Eligibility Verification) audits?
Choice Percent of Cases
Not applicable, we have not uncovered false documentation issues during I-9 audits
53%
Allow employees the opportunity to provide correct documentation within a specific time period
35%
Terminate employees immediately 13%
No set procedure/practice in place 11%
Report employees to immigration authorities 3%
Other 2%
